0wl18 1,672 Posted October 19, 2020 Share Posted October 19, 2020 It’s a poorly timed challenge. No malice. Ridiculous uproar for very little. The focus should be in the standard of officiating. VAR isn’t the issue, it’s the complete and utter numpties implementing it! The Sane offside decision was pathetic. A TalkSport caller nailed it yesterday. He recommended that officials be shown the still at the moment it’s believed the ball was kicked. Do away with the lines and, let the official decide if there’s enough evidence to clearly say the player was offside. The technology doesn’t exist to determine when the ball was actually struck. When the decision is as close as the Sane one, where he’s actually dead level, that’s the difference between offside and onside. Until that technology is available there’s physically no way to say that a player is 100% offside when it’s as close as that. Link to post Share on other sites

latemodelchild 9,792 Posted October 19, 2020 Share Posted October 19, 2020 On the subject of offsides and the fine margins. When a player plays the ball forward, at what point do they pause it for the lines to be drawn in? Is it when the ball leaves the boot or when the ball first touches the boot? We are constantly shown offsides that are a gnats pube off but never get to see how close it is at the other end of the pass. I don't believe they get every single freeze frame right on the money. There seems to be no margin for error accounted for. Link to post Share on other sites
